[QUOTE="BlueWhale, post: 1807876, member: 53960"] Wondering where this sensor is located or is it a set of sensors. I've had Gen 3 for about 3 months now and find reading is overstated significantly. I'm referring to readout on the center console upper right . This weekend it showed 112 F, while outside temp was about 78. After getting in car driving for few minutes, it went down to the 90's but it's still not close to real temp, nor is it anywhere close to cabin temp. Also, I'm speculating if this issue is also causing my AC seemingly random problem where Fan speed /AC goes to bare min yet controls are at Max. No cold air. Dealer already documented problem but no fix yet. IF i reset ( stop and turn off vehicle and back on). AC goes back to normal working. We also find that turning off all air/ac for about 15 or so minutes also does the trick. But this is total PITA, especially during hot summer days now. [/QUOTE]
